- 博客(9)
- 收藏
- 关注
原创 Shiro自定義登錄驗證
shiro自帶了一套登錄驗證的邏輯,下面以SimpleCredentialsMatcher的實現爲例 /** * This implementation acquires the {@code token}'s credentials * (via {@link #getCredentials(AuthenticationToken) getCredentials(token)}) * and then the {@code account}'s credentia
2022-03-26 23:07:25
165
原创 mybatis3.4.6~.3.0.6 區別
1、低版本DAO 增刪改操作,只能返回INT(更新記錄數);高版本可返回boolean(操作結果)。2、低版本注入寫法${name} 需注意null處理,如果傳入null,渲染sql時會直接輸入null導致報錯,應判斷為null時轉成空字符"";高版本null 會忽略相當於空字符""。3、低版本用實體類時,如果調用實體類沒有的屬性會報錯;高版本即使實體類沒有定義屬性也不會報錯。例如:select name from user .如果沒有定義name ,低版本執行會報錯,高版本不會。...
2022-03-23 19:14:01
542
原创 Spring-boot + Mybatis3.0.6配置 鏈接db2as400方案
項目需要兼容較老的db2 as400 ,故需要使用老版本mybatis但是在網上搜了很久沒有相關文檔,踩了很多坑,所以將自己摸索了三天的相關配置分享記錄一下<!-- 降低mybatis版本,兼容as400數據庫驅動jt400 start --> <dependency> <groupId>org.springframework</groupId> <artifa
2022-03-21 15:13:08
935
转载 websphere配置jndi參考文檔
Websphere配置JNDI连接- FineReport帮助文档|报表开发|报表使用|学习教程記錄一下參考文檔,侵告立刪;
2022-02-17 19:28:21
275
原创 Java 配置Maria數據庫
最近項目使用了冷門的mariadb,發現相關配置的文章很少所以記錄一下;先是在pom配置依賴<dependency> <groupId>org.mariadb.jdbc</groupId> <artifactId>mariadb-java-client</artifactId> <version>2.7.4</version></depende...
2021-09-11 00:27:47
250
原创 @Test测试时,initializationError
使用Junit测试代码时,报了initializationError的错误,进过不断的检验发现不是代码问题于是更换Junit 的jar包版本,还是出现initializationError错误,最后发现是测试方法没加public修饰,所以方法没被识别到,只要加上就可以正常运行测试了!...
2018-03-20 10:24:45
1530
原创 spring Failed to convert property value of type 'java.lang.String' to required type 'int' for proper
编写SSM框架的项目时遇到,spring Failed to convert property value of type 'java.lang.String' to required type 'int' for proper找了半天发现原来是*mapper.xml 的一对<select>标签的prameterType 属性 写成了prameterMAP因为传入的是多个参数...
2018-03-19 15:14:18
5731
原创 在CMD查看Mysql数据时出现中文乱码
当使用CMD访问Mysql数据库时,中文数据出现乱码 解决方法:输入命令 set character_set_results=GBK; 即可(要在cmd中显示正常的中文必须是GBK)另外:如果还是不行可能是添加数据时的数据源字符集与Mysql不符,可以尝试输入命令 set character_set_client=charset; (charset 就是数据源的字符集),然后重...
2018-03-14 18:27:16
1249
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人